对象存储 nas存储区别大不大,深入解析,对象存储与NAS存储的差异化对比
- 综合资讯
- 2024-11-25 18:17:28
- 3

对象存储与NAS存储在架构和用途上存在显著差异。对象存储以海量、非结构化数据存储为主,采用分布式架构,适用于大数据场景;而NAS存储则面向块和文件级别的存储,适合轻量级...
对象存储与NAS存储在架构和用途上存在显著差异。对象存储以海量、非结构化数据存储为主,采用分布式架构,适用于大数据场景;而NAS存储则面向块和文件级别的存储,适合轻量级、高性能的应用。两者在性能、可扩展性、数据访问方式等方面各有优势,具体应用场景需根据实际需求选择。
随着云计算的飞速发展,数据存储技术也在不断进步,对象存储(Object Storage)和NAS(Network Attached Storage)作为当前主流的存储方式,被广泛应用于企业、政府和科研机构等各个领域,本文将从以下几个方面对比分析对象存储与NAS存储的差异化,以帮助读者更好地了解两者之间的区别。
存储架构
1、对象存储:采用分布式存储架构,将数据存储在多个节点上,节点之间通过网络进行数据同步和备份,对象存储系统具有高可用性、高扩展性等特点,适用于大规模数据存储。
2、NAS存储:采用集中式存储架构,数据存储在统一的存储设备上,NAS存储系统通常采用RAID技术进行数据冗余,提高数据安全性。
存储性能
1、对象存储:对象存储系统在设计上追求高吞吐量、低延迟,适用于大规模数据存储场景,在读写性能方面,对象存储系统具有较好的线性扩展能力,但随着数据量的增加,性能提升可能受到影响。
2、NAS存储:NAS存储系统在读写性能方面相对较好,但受限于存储设备本身的性能,扩展性较差,在处理大量并发请求时,性能可能会出现瓶颈。
数据访问方式
1、对象存储:对象存储系统采用RESTful API进行数据访问,支持HTTP、HTTPS等协议,用户可以通过编程方式实现对数据的上传、下载、查询等操作。
2、NAS存储:NAS存储系统提供文件系统接口,支持常见的文件操作,如创建、删除、修改等,用户可以通过文件系统访问数据,如NFS、SMB等。
数据安全性
1、对象存储:对象存储系统通常采用多节点存储,数据在多个节点间进行冗余备份,降低数据丢失风险,对象存储系统支持数据加密、访问控制等安全特性。
2、NAS存储:NAS存储系统通过RAID技术提高数据安全性,同时支持数据加密、访问控制等安全特性,但相较于对象存储,NAS存储系统的数据安全性相对较低。
应用场景
1、对象存储:适用于大规模数据存储场景,如视频监控、大数据分析、云存储等,对象存储系统可以方便地扩展存储容量,满足不断增长的数据需求。
2、NAS存储:适用于中小规模数据存储场景,如企业内部文件共享、个人存储等,NAS存储系统便于管理和维护,用户可以通过简单的文件操作访问数据。
成本
1、对象存储:对象存储系统通常采用按需付费的模式,用户只需为实际使用的存储空间付费,对象存储系统具有较好的线性扩展能力,降低了长期运维成本。
2、NAS存储:NAS存储系统通常采用一次性采购的方式,用户需要支付设备购置成本、软件许可费用等,长期来看,NAS存储系统的成本相对较高。
对象存储与NAS存储在存储架构、性能、数据访问方式、安全性、应用场景和成本等方面存在较大差异,用户在选择存储方案时,应根据自身业务需求、数据规模、性能要求等因素进行综合考虑,对于大规模数据存储场景,对象存储具有更高的性价比;而对于中小规模数据存储场景,NAS存储则更为适合。
本文链接:https://www.zhitaoyun.cn/1074161.html
发表评论